Load Capacity and Size

One crucial aspect to consider when choosing a hydraulic dock lift is its load capacity. The load capacity refers to the maximum weight that the lift can safely handle. It is important to select a dock lift with a load capacity that exceeds the heaviest load you anticipate handling in order to ensure safe operations.

Additionally, consider the size of both your loads and your loading bay when choosing a hydraulic dock lift. Take into account both width and length dimensions to ensure that there is enough space for seamless loading and unloading operations. Also, consider any height restrictions that may be present in your facility.

Safety Features

Safety should always be a top priority when selecting any piece of equipment for your loading dock. Look for hydraulic dock lifts that are equipped with essential safety features such as non-slip platforms, safety rails or gates, emergency stop buttons, overload protection systems, and audible alarms.

Another crucial safety feature to consider is maintenance support. Opting for a reputable manufacturer who offers regular maintenance services ensures that your hydraulic dock lift is kept in optimal condition, reducing the risk of accidents and breakdowns.

Durability and Longevity

Investing in a hydraulic dock lift is a significant decision, and you’ll want to ensure that your chosen lift offers durability and longevity. Look for lifts that are constructed from high-quality materials such as steel, which can withstand heavy usage and harsh environmental conditions.

Additionally, consider the reputation of the manufacturer when it comes to durability. Reading customer reviews and testimonials can provide valuable insights into the performance and lifespan of different hydraulic dock lifts.
